Understanding Retail Shop Fixtures Enhancing Customer Experience and Sales


In the realm of retail, the physical layout of a store plays a vital role in attracting customers and driving sales. One of the most critical elements of this layout is the use of retail shop fixtures. These fixtures encompass a wide range of items, from shelves and racks to displays and mannequins, all strategically designed to create an inviting shopping environment. Understanding the importance of these fixtures can be pivotal for retail success.


Types of Retail Shop Fixtures


Retail shop fixtures come in various forms, each serving specific functions to enhance the shopping experience. Shelving units are among the most common fixtures, utilized to display products in an organized manner. They come in many styles, including wall-mounted shelves, freestanding units, and gondola shelving, allowing retailers to optimize their space according to their merchandising needs.


Display cases are another essential component, especially for items that require protection or elevation, such as jewelry or high-end electronics. These cases not only highlight the products but also add a layer of security. Similarly, mannequins and dress forms are used in clothing stores to showcase apparel creatively, making it easier for customers to envision how the clothing would look when worn.


The Role of Retail Shop Fixtures in Customer Experience


Creating an engaging shopping environment is crucial in today's competitive retail landscape. Effective use of retail fixtures can significantly enhance the customer experience. For instance, well-organized displays guide customers through the store, making it easier to locate desired products. Thoughtfully arranged merchandise can inspire impulse purchases as shoppers are drawn to attractive setups.

Moreover, the right fixtures can also communicate a brand's identity. High-end retailers may opt for sleek, minimalistic fixtures that reflect luxury, while boutiques may prefer more eclectic and artistic arrangements to convey uniqueness. When fixtures align with brand aesthetics, they contribute to a cohesive shopping experience, reinforcing brand imagery in customers' minds.


Impact on Sales


The impact of retail shop fixtures on sales cannot be overstated. Studies have shown that stores that invest in high-quality fixtures often see higher conversion rates. This is due to the psychological effects of a well-organized space. When customers can easily navigate a store and enjoy visually appealing displays, they are more likely to make purchasing decisions.


Additionally, strategically placed fixtures can encourage product interaction. For example, allowing customers to touch and try items can lead to increased sales, particularly in categories like clothing and home goods. Retailers can use fixtures to create inviting spaces that promote this interaction, making it an integral part of the shopping journey.
